Many construction companies estimate costs in Excel and track expenses in accounting software. There is no link between site consumption and financial reporting. This causes cost overruns, late vendor payments, and disputes with clients. Lack of item-level tracking makes it hard to know which activity or subcontractor is reducing profit.
Cash flow is another major issue. Advance payments, retention amounts, and progressive billing require structured tracking. Without integrated ERP, receivables are delayed and working capital shrinks. A connected project costing engine ensures every material issue, labor hour, and equipment usage directly updates project profitability in real time.
Construction sites depend on correct allocation of engineers, supervisors, skilled workers, and machines. When planning is manual, companies either overstaff or face shortages. Both situations increase cost and delay completion. Our ERP platform maps resources to project tasks and shows utilization percentage for each role and asset.
Equipment mismanagement is expensive. Idle machinery increases depreciation without revenue. Overused machines increase breakdown risk. With preventive maintenance scheduling and usage-based tracking, companies protect assets and reduce downtime. Resource planning becomes a strategic advantage instead of a daily firefighting activity.
